Hamza Zeghari

Professional Summary

Full-stack developer with 5+ years of experience specializing in building scalable web applications using modern technologies. Proficient in React, TypeScript, Node.js, and Nest.js. Currently contributing to platform development at IZI Safety while maintaining a strong focus on code quality, team collaboration, and continuous improvement.

Relevant Experience

Full-Stack Developer

IZI SafetyCasablanca

Jun 2023 - Present
  • Engaging in the development and enhancement of various features within the IZI Safety platform, contributing to overall system functionality and user experience
  • Collaborating with cross-functional teams to identify and resolve issues, ensuring smooth operation and performance of the platform
  • Implementing new features and improvements to enhance user management and system efficiency
  • Conducting thorough testing and debugging of APIs to ensure seamless integration and functionality
  • Participating in daily stand-up meetings, retrospective meetings, planning sessions, and grooming activities to align with team goals and enhance collaboration
  • Preparing technical documentation and reports on system performance and ongoing improvements to facilitate knowledge sharing within the team
React.jsTypeScriptTailwind CSSAnt DesignReduxReact QueryNest.jsTypeORMNode.jsExpress.jsMongoDBSQLGitDockerPostmanFigma

Full-Stack Developer

FreelanceCasablanca

Jun 2020 - May 2023
  • Developed and maintained back-office and web applications, focusing on optimizing user interfaces and enhancing back-end functionality
  • Managed projects from initial analysis and design to final deployment
  • Marscan: Developed a comprehensive web application for a company specializing in food and feed product importation, utilizing React.js for front-end development and Node.js for back-end functionality, deployed on a VPS
React.jsNode.jsExpress.jsMongoDBVPS

Full-Stack Developer

AppliteCasablanca

Sep 2019 - Jun 2020
  • Project 1: Developed Client Accounts Management Module for Back-office System using React, JavaScript, Node.js, Express.js and Socket.IO
  • Project 2: Maintained Web Application for Online Order Taking using PHP, Laravel, HTML/CSS/JS, jQuery and MySQL
ReactJavaScriptNode.jsExpress.jsSocket.IOPHPLaraveljQueryMySQL
→ View Project

Education

Professional Bachelor in Application Design and Development Engineering

FST SETTATCasablanca

2018 - 2019

Diploma Technician Specialized in IT Development

IFIAG CasablancaCasablanca

2016 - 2018

High School Degree in Physics and Chemistry

El JoulaneMohammedia

2014 - 2015

Certifications

Spring Boot - RestFul API

Bright Coding2023

ID: In Progress

GIT & GITHUB

Bright Coding2021

ID: 313A65CA

MTA: Using JavaScript

Microsoft2021

CCNA: Routing & Switching

Cisco2018

Technical Skills

Programming Languages

JavaScript (ES6+)TypeScriptHTMLCSS/SassGraphQLPythonPHP

Frameworks & Libraries

ReactNode.jsExpress.jsNest.jsjQueryAngularTailwind CSSLaravel

Databases

MongoDBSQLMySQL

Tools & Platforms

GitDockerWebpackPostmanContentfulNetlifyHerokuWordPressFirebaseRedis

Design Tools

Figma

Tip: Use "Save as PDF" in the print dialog for best results